Overview

I (Kurt Van Dijck) wrote this application to use OpenMoko as a 1D or 2D levelling tool.

Features

  • You can select which of the 2 accelerometers to use (or use them both, but I'm not aware how exactly they are positioned)
  • easy calibration: The program remembers 6 calibration values: 3 axis on 2 sensors.
  • Any 3 axis for 1D levelling
  • Any of 3 combined axis for 2D levelling
